Research Insights on Yoga's Impact
What does research say about the impact of yoga?
Uma Kumar, the Head of the Rheumatology Department at AIIMS, Delhi, highlights that yoga has demonstrated beneficial effects for patients with various health conditions. Research focusing on individuals with rheumatoid arthritis and fibromyalgia has uncovered numerous advantages associated with yoga practice.
Combining Yoga with Medication for Enhanced Results
Better results with a combination of medication and yoga
Experts indicate that patients who engage in regular yoga practice alongside their prescribed medications experience significant improvements. These individuals report better sleep quality, reduced stress levels, diminished negative thoughts, and an overall enhancement in their quality of life. Additionally, they often find relief from pain.
Cellular Benefits of Yoga
Positive changes were observed at the cellular level, too
Dr. Uma Kumar notes that the benefits of yoga extend beyond physical health. Research indicates that individuals practicing yoga exhibit lower inflammatory markers and enhanced cellular function. Moreover, there is a reduction in oxidative stress and an improvement in mitochondrial function.
The Importance of Yoga for Arthritis Patients
Why is yoga essential for arthritis patients?
Experts assert that yoga can be especially advantageous for those suffering from arthritis. It aids in maintaining flexibility, enhancing joint function, and simplifying daily activities. The benefits of yoga are not confined to arthritis patients; they extend to individuals of all ages.
Enhancing Joint Flexibility and Mobility
Improving Joint Flexibility and Mobility
According to specialists at AIIMS, consistent yoga practice has been shown to enhance body flexibility. Research suggests that individuals who engage in yoga experience an increased range of motion in their joints and a decrease in inflammation, facilitating easier completion of daily tasks.
Alleviating Joint Pain through Yoga
Relief from Joint Pain
Experts recommend that practicing yoga under the supervision of a qualified instructor can alleviate joint pain. When performed correctly, yoga postures help relax muscles and promote greater physical activity.
Yoga Poses for Back Pain Relief
Yoga Postures for Back Pain
Postures such as *Bhujangasana* (Cobra Pose) and *Shalabhasana* (Locust Pose) are particularly beneficial for individuals experiencing back pain. Additionally, gentle stretching, body rotations, and neck exercises can aid in muscle relaxation and improve overall mobility.
